N564 YTF is a 1996 BMW R Series in Black with a 1,085c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 20 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 75%.
Across all 1996 BMW R Series models, the average MOT pass rate is 87.4% with a typical mileage of 45,396 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a BMW R Series fails its MOT is tyre tread depth is below minimum requirements of 1.0mm, accounting for 1,440 recorded failures. If you're considering buying N564 YTF,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W R Series typically stays on UK roads for around 49 years. At 30 years old, this BMW R Series is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
